Theasy.com In his first Edinburgh fringe show Van Gogh Find Yourself, (#VGFY), NYC based actor, artist, and writer Walter DeForest gives the audience a chance to have an intimate moment with Vincent van Gogh, experiencing the passion, humour, and heArt of a great artist. This intriguing interactive portrait play is written and performed by DeForest whose dramaturg is based on scores of letters between Vincent and his brother Theo, and a short memoir written by Adeline Ravoux, which details Van Gogh's stay in Auvers-sur-Oise. Van Gogh Find Yourself (#vgfy) sets the record straight on Vincent's personal struggle for humanity. Audiences get to spend an afternoon behind the scenes with a great artist, watch him work, and more. DeForest, who has a striking physical resemblance to Van Gogh, tells Vincent's side all whilst drawing portraits and conversing with the audience. Commenting on the show which played to sold out houses at the 2015 FringeNYC , Walter DeForest states that "#vgfy is a different show every time. Just as a blank canvas never produces the exact same result, each performance will reveal a unique portrait of Vincent".
